IP查询
查询
你查询的IP:[114.80.17.85] 地理位置:中国–上海–上海电信/IDC机房
最新查询
123.128.247.27
218.96.116.124
114.80.184.14
119.19.72.49
119.144.1.250
119.254.129.7
203.86.33.194
116.244.204.144
161.207.152.119
121.255.32.221
114.80.17.85
203.190.96.22
119.78.77.143
121.201.18.44
198.17.7.5
118.228.173.42
203.208.16.201
125.31.192.225
221.129.44.219
202.165.176.83
202.170.216.1
118.244.24.40
119.128.38.124
116.213.64.0
221.153.72.146
116.255.128.205
61.128.142.165
121.58.144.138
58.100.67.151
61.87.192.187
58.116.203.28
124.128.8.147